Output e590d76da083563839fac9109be831b75827506f316bdec12bf514bdba38cfd8:14

value
290199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d12f005e557d5c6818a1ac6a520c1f90c428f802 OP_EQUAL
address
3Lm5TMTgGSuUPtMPmiKrWfo4gpPJ3F593N
transaction
e590d76da083563839fac9109be831b75827506f316bdec12bf514bdba38cfd8
spent
true